General Information:

Parallelism is common in Hebrew poetry. (See: rc://en/ta/man/translate/writing-poetry and r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-parallelism)

For the chief musician

"This is for the director of music to use in worship."

I waited patiently for Yahweh

This means the writer was waiting for Yahweh to help him.

he listened to me ... heard my cry

These mean the same thing, and can be combined into one statement. AT: "he listened to me when I called out to him" (See: r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-doublet)
